Energy storage unit and energy storage battery
The energy storage unit and battery improve assembly and disassembly efficiency by using connection structures on side end surfaces of modules, addressing convenience and maintenance challenges with fasteners and recessed handle grooves, ensuring efficient and cost-effective operation.

[0001] The present invention relates to the field of battery technology, and more particularly to energy storage units and energy storage batteries. [Background technology]
[0002] With the development and application of photovoltaic power generation systems, home photovoltaic energy storage systems have been widely adopted due to their advantages, such as grid-connected and stand-alone operation, the ability to transfer surplus power back to the grid when grid-connected, and self-consumption during nighttime and cloudy or rainy days. In home photovoltaic energy storage systems, the battery system consists of a battery module and a control module. Commonly used battery systems are mainly divided into integrated cabinet types and independent module stack types. Independent module stack battery boxes have the advantages of small volume, light weight, convenient transportation and installation maintenance, small footprint, no need for cranes or forklifts, one-person installation of the battery box, and easy subsequent expansion and upgrade. Therefore, in the prior art, multiple modular assembly batteries have been developed.
[0003] For example, the power supply cabinet disclosed in publication number CN206099077U solves the problem of battery modular assembly, but the following problems exist in actual use:
[0004] 1. The locking device needs to be pre-installed in the box body, which increases the cost of the locking device and requires high installation accuracy for multiple products, making mass production and maintenance inconvenient.
[0005] 2. After the entire battery system is stacked and installed, if the lower battery box component requires maintenance on its own, the upper battery box component must be removed and the cover must be opened to perform maintenance.
[0006] 3. The handle of the box body is exposed to the outside, and the welded seam of the handle will be exposed to the outside for a long period of time, which not only poses a risk of rust but also affects the overall aesthetics of the product.
[0007] In addition, for example, Publication No. CN209447901U discloses a stacked battery pack, which can also solve the problem of battery modular assembly, but there are the following problems in actual use.
[0008] 1. The external fixing device has an integrated structure. When arranging different battery capacities, different connecting plates or connecting rods must be provided. In addition, the laminated structure has accumulated errors, so the processing and assembly of parts requires certain tolerances, which makes on-site installation and maintenance and subsequent system expansion inconvenient.
[0009] 2. After the entire battery system is stacked and installed, if the lower battery box component requires maintenance on its own, the upper battery box component must be removed and the cover must be opened to perform maintenance.
[0010] 3. The handle of the box body may leak, and the welded joint of the handle may leak over time, which may cause rust and affect the overall aesthetics of the product.
[0011] Therefore, the two technical solutions already existing in the prior art have the problem of being inconvenient to use in practice. Summary of the Invention [Problem to be solved by the invention]

D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F THE INVENTION
[0037] In order to allow those skilled in the art to better understand the technical solution of the present invention, the lining device and semiconductor processing device provided by the embodiments of the present invention will be described in detail below in conjunction with the drawings, which are all simplified structural conceptual diagrams and are only used to schematically explain the basic structure of the present invention, and therefore only show the components relevant to the present invention.
[0038] Example 1 1 to 8 , this embodiment provides an energy storage unit, which includes a connection structure and at least two battery modules 300, the at least two battery modules 300 being stacked, and at least one pair of opposing side end surfaces of each of two adjacent battery modules 300 being provided with a connection structure, the connection structure being used to fasten the two adjacent battery modules 300. That is, the fastening connection between the two battery modules 300 is realized by fastening the at least one pair of opposing side end surfaces of each of the two adjacent battery modules 300, i.e., the fastening connection between the two adjacent battery modules 300 can be achieved by fastening the at least one pair of opposing side end surfaces of each of the two adjacent battery modules 300 with the connection structure.
[0039] In the energy storage unit provided by the embodiments of the present invention, with respect to the stacked battery modules 300, a connecting structure is provided on at least one opposing side end surface of each pair of adjacent battery modules 300, so that the two adjacent battery modules 300 can be fastened and connected using the connecting structure. This not only improves the convenience of assembling a plurality of battery modules 300, but also makes it possible to inspect and maintain some battery modules 300 without having to remove all of the battery modules 300, by simply removing the connecting structure connected to the battery module 300 that requires inspection and maintenance. Therefore, by only locally removing the plurality of battery modules 300 in the energy storage unit, the battery modules 300 that require inspection and maintenance can be inspected and maintained. This improves the convenience of removal when inspecting and maintaining the battery modules 300, and also makes the installation and removal of the energy storage unit more efficient.
[0040] From the perspective of assembly efficiency and the cost of the overall structure, when the drawings of this embodiment are combined, it can be seen that the connection structure can be used only to realize the connection between one pair of opposing side end surfaces of each of two adjacent battery modules 300, that is, by fastening and connecting only one pair of opposing side end surfaces of each of two adjacent battery modules 300 using the connection structure, the number of connection structures used can be reduced, thereby improving the assembly efficiency of each of two adjacent battery modules 300 while reducing the cost of the overall structure of the energy storage unit.
[0041] For example, in the case of three battery modules 300 stacked vertically, from bottom to top, the connection structure fastens the top portion of the lowest battery module 300 to the bottom portion of the middle battery module 300. Furthermore, the top portion of the middle battery module 300 is fixed to the bottom portion of the uppermost battery module 300 by the connection structure, thus completing the snap connection between the middle battery module 300 and the top battery module 300. That is, three battery modules 300 are stacked vertically, and a position near the top of a pair of opposing side end faces of the middle battery module 300 is fastened to a position near the bottom of a pair of opposing side end faces of the upper battery module 300 using a connection structure, thereby realizing the fastening connection between the middle battery module 300 and the upper battery module 300; and a position near the bottom of a pair of opposing side end faces of the middle battery module 300 is fastened to a position near the top of a pair of opposing side end faces of the lower battery module 300 using a connection structure, thereby realizing the fastening connection between the middle battery module 300 and the lower battery module 300. Based on the above, through the above process, the three battery modules 300 are overall fixed after being stacked vertically. That is, with regard to the energy storage unit of this embodiment, regardless of how many battery modules 300 the energy storage unit includes, it is only necessary that there be a connection structure between each two adjacent battery modules 300, and such a structure is convenient for expanding or reducing the volume of the energy storage unit according to actual usage needs during a specific usage process.
[0042] However, the stacking method of the at least two battery modules 300 is not limited to the vertical stacking.
[0043] In this embodiment, the connection structure may include a connection plate 200 and a fastener, and the fastener is used to fasten the connection plate 200 to the battery module 300. It should be noted here that the specific shape of the connection plate 200 is not absolutely limited in this embodiment, and the connection plate 200 may have a flat structure, or may be manufactured to fit the specific shape of the side end surface of the battery module 300 on which the connection plate 200 is to be disposed. In other words, the shape of the connection plate 200 can be adjusted according to the side end surface of the battery module 300 to be connected thereto. Therefore, there is no need to modify the battery module 300; simply modifying the connection plate 200 allows the connection plate 200 to fasten two adjacent battery modules 300 together. This minimizes the need to modify the battery module 300 itself, while still achieving the effect of connecting multiple battery modules 300.
[0044] As an optional embodiment, an example is given. Considering the convenience and efficiency of installation and removal, the fastener in this embodiment may include a screw 600. Based on this structure, in consideration of engagement with the fastener, a screw hole 2 for fitting with the screw 600 is provided on the side end surface of the battery module 300, and a connection hole 201 suitable for passing the screw 600 is provided on the connection plate 200. In actual application, the screw 600 can be passed through the connection hole 201 and threadedly engaged with the screw hole 2, thereby fastening and connecting the connection plate 200 and the battery module 300 with the screw 600.
[0045] However, the type of fastener is not limited to the screw 600. For example, the fastener may have a male thread, a screw hole 2 may be formed on a side end surface of the battery module 300 to engage with the male thread on the fastener, and a connection hole 201 may be formed on the connection plate 200 to pass through the connection hole 201. In actual application, the fastener may be passed through the connection hole 201, and the male thread of the fastener may be threadedly engaged with the screw hole 2, thereby fastening and connecting the connection plate 200 and the battery module 300 together.
[0046] Regarding the energy storage unit provided by the embodiment of the present invention, a simple connecting plate 200 is used to engage with fasteners to achieve fastening connection of adjacent battery modules 300. This method has a simple structure and relatively low overall material and assembly costs. In addition, the fasteners can be engaged on the battery modules 300 by simply designing, for example, screw holes 2 according to the embodiment of the present invention. In this case, the structure of the battery modules 300 themselves requires little modification, i.e., there is no need to invest excessive cost in improving the structure of the battery modules 300 themselves. This allows the overall cost of the energy storage unit provided by the embodiment of the present invention to be kept within a relatively low range.
[0047] Furthermore, to further explain, the rectangular parallelepiped battery module 300 provided in this embodiment has four vertical side end faces, which are divided into two pairs, one pair of which corresponds to the length of the battery module 300, and the other pair of vertical side end faces corresponds to the width of the battery module 300. Based on this structure, when the connection structure is provided only on one pair of side end faces, in consideration of cost reduction, the connection structure of this embodiment can be attached to the pair of vertical side end faces of the battery module 300 that corresponds to the width of the battery module 300. In other words, when the battery module 300 has multiple pairs of side end faces with different lengths and the connection structure is connected to only one pair of the side end faces, the connection structure can be selected to connect to the shorter pair of side end faces, thereby reducing the length of the connecting plate 200. This not only serves to fix the stacked battery modules 300, but also saves material for the connection plate 200, thereby reducing material costs.
[0048] However, the shape of the battery module 300 is not limited to a rectangular parallelepiped.
[0049] Based on the above structure, in order to further improve the robustness and stability of the vertically stacked battery modules 300 when used in a stacked state, in any embodiment, a corresponding first limit structure may be provided on two opposing end surfaces of each of two adjacent battery modules 300, and the first limit structure is used to determine the relative positions of the two adjacent battery modules. To illustrate an example of the first limit structure with reference to the drawings, in two adjacent battery modules 300, a protruding post 1 is provided on one end of the lower battery module 300 facing the upper battery module 300, and a positioning hole 6 is provided on one end of the upper battery module 300 facing the lower battery module 300, which is used to engage with the protruding post 1. In actual application, when the upper battery module 300 is stacked on the lower battery module 300, the protruding post 1 is inserted into the positioning hole 6, and the protruding post 1 and the positioning hole 6 are used to determine the relative positions of the two adjacent battery modules 300. In this situation, for the same battery module 300, depending on the state of stacking in the vertical direction, a protruding post 1 is provided on the top end surface of the battery module 300, and a positioning hole 6 is provided on the bottom end surface. Of course, the installation positions of the protruding post 1 and the positioning hole 6 here can be interchanged; that is, for the same battery module 300, depending on the state of stacking in the vertical direction, a positioning hole 6 can be provided on the top end surface of the battery module 300, and a protruding post 1 can be provided on the bottom end surface, and this embodiment does not impose any absolute limitations on this.
[0050] When the connection structure is attached to a pair of vertical side end faces corresponding to the width direction of the battery module 300, one side end face is selected from the pair of vertical side end faces corresponding to the length direction of the battery module 300 and used as the cover plate 301 of the battery module 300.In this way, when inspection and maintenance of the battery module 300 is required, the cover plate 301 can be removed and the inspection and maintenance can be performed on the battery module 300 that requires inspection and maintenance.This does not affect the connection structure, and there is no need to remove the energy storage unit in which multiple battery modules 300 are stacked, thereby achieving the effect of inspection and maintenance.
[0051] To further explain the energy storage unit of this embodiment, a recessed handle groove 302 may be formed on the outer wall of the battery module 300, and the handle groove 302 is used for handling operations during production installation and logistics transportation. Using the drawings to illustrate an optional implementation, the handle groove 302 may be formed on a side end surface that is compatible with the connection structure of the battery modules 300. After the connecting plate 200 is connected to two adjacent battery modules 300, the connecting plate 200 can cover the handle groove 302, which can effectively protect the welded joints of the handle and improve the aesthetic appearance of the entire energy storage unit. However, the handle groove 302 here is specifically formed on the battery module 300, and the specific outer wall is not an absolute limitation in this embodiment. For example, the handle groove 302 may be formed on one of a pair of longitudinal side end surfaces of the battery module 300 corresponding to its length direction, where the cover plate 301 is not provided.
[0052] In addition, as an optional implementation, the battery modules 300 employed in the energy storage unit of this embodiment may be provided with outer bosses 306 on their longitudinal side edges corresponding to their widthwise directions to increase the strength of the side edges of the battery modules 300. Based on this structure, the outer bosses 306 may be installed so as to avoid the connection plate 200, or may be covered by the connection plate 200 after the connection plate 200 is connected to two adjacent battery modules 300. In the case where the connection plate 200 covers the outer bosses 306, a structure appropriate for the shape of the outer bosses 306 can be pre-fabricated on the connection plate 200 to meet usage needs. The drawings in this embodiment merely illustrate a configuration in which the connection plate 200 and the outer boss 306 are separate and independent from each other, i.e., a configuration in which the outer boss 306 is installed so as to avoid the connection plate 200, and are not intended to be an absolute limitation.
[0053] Finally, to further explain the energy storage unit of this embodiment, a corresponding first electrical connection structure is provided on two opposing end surfaces of each of two adjacent battery modules 300, and the first electrical connection structure is used to electrically connect the two adjacent battery modules 300, thereby achieving the electrical connection between each of the two adjacent battery modules 300. Referring to the drawings, in terms of the distance of the first electrical connection structure, an upper electrical connector 3 is provided on one end surface of the lower battery module 300 facing the upper battery module 300, and a lower electrical connector 5 engaging with the upper electrical connector 3 is provided on one end surface of the upper battery module 300 facing the lower battery module 300. In actual application, when the upper battery module 300 is stacked on the lower battery module 300, the upper electrical connector 3 and the lower electrical connector 5 are electrically connected, and the upper electrical connector 3 and the lower electrical connector 5 are used to electrically connect the two adjacent battery modules 300. In this situation, for the same battery module 300, due to its vertical stacking state, an upper electrical connector 3 is provided on the top end surface of the battery module 300, and a lower electrical connector 5 is provided on the bottom end surface thereof.
[0054] Example 2 As shown in Figures 1 to 9, based on the energy storage unit of Example 1, this example further provides an energy storage battery including a base 100, a control module 500, and the energy storage unit of Example 1, where the base 100 and the control module 500 are respectively provided at both ends of the energy storage unit.
[0055] The energy storage battery provided by the embodiments of the present invention can utilize the energy storage unit provided by the embodiments of the present invention to improve the convenience of attaching and detaching the energy storage unit, thereby making the attachment and detachment of the energy storage unit more efficient, and further improving the convenience of attaching and detaching the energy storage battery, making the attachment and detachment of the energy storage battery more efficient.
[0056] For example, the base 100 can be connected to the bottom of the battery module 300 located at the bottom of the energy storage unit, and the control module 500 can be connected to the top of the battery module 300 located at the top of the energy storage unit, so that the base 100 and the control module 500 are respectively provided at both ends of the energy storage unit.
[0057] Optionally, the base 100 and the adjacent battery module 300 may be fastened together by a connection structure, and the control module 500 and the adjacent battery module 300 may be fastened together by a connection structure. Note that, as an optional implementation, the connection structure for fastening the base 100 and the energy storage unit and the connection structure for fastening the control module 500 and the energy storage unit may be the same as the connection structure in Example 1. In addition, the specific connection structure here can refer to the specific installation position of the control module 500 on the base 100, i.e., the control module 500 may be located on the corresponding longitudinal side edge surface in the width direction of the base 100.
[0058] In another optional implementation, the side end surface of the control module 500 that is fastened to the connection structure may be provided with an inwardly recessed external wiring groove 505. The external wiring groove 505 is used for external wiring operation and electrical connection of the energy storage battery, and is covered when not in use. Considering this, the connecting plate 200 that fastens and connects the control module 500 to the energy storage unit may be longer in size, that is, the size of the connecting plate 200 that fastens and connects the control module 500 to the battery module 300 adjacent to the control module 500 may be larger than the size of the connecting plate 200 that fastens and connects each of the two adjacent battery modules 300.
[0059] To further explain the control module 500 of this embodiment, one side end face can be selected from a pair of vertical side end faces corresponding to the length of the control module 500 to serve as a control cover plate 501 of the control module 500, which is used for installing and maintaining the energy storage battery. That is, when inspection and maintenance of the control module 500 is required, the control cover plate 501 can be removed to inspect and maintain the control module 500 without being affected by the connection structure. Another side end face can be selected from the pair of vertical side end faces corresponding to the length of the control module 500 to provide an indicator structure 504 for indicating the operating status of the energy storage battery.
[0060] Furthermore, in this embodiment, the base 100 and the adjacent battery module 300 are provided with a corresponding second electrical connection structure, and the control module 500 and the adjacent battery module 300 are provided with a corresponding third electrical connection structure. The second and third electrical connection structures here may be similar to the first electrical connection structure in the first embodiment and will not be further described here. However, because the control module 500 is located at the top of the energy storage battery, it is only necessary to install the lower electrical connector 5, which is compatible with the battery module 300 located at the top of the energy storage unit, at the bottom of the control module 500, and it is not necessary to install the upper electrical connector 3 at the top of the control module 500. On the other hand, because the base 100 is located at the bottom of the energy storage battery, it is only necessary to install the upper electrical connector 3, which is compatible with the battery module 300 located at the bottom of the energy storage unit, at the top of the base 100, and it is not necessary to install the lower electrical connector 5 at the bottom of the base 100.
[0061] Based on the above structure, to further enhance the robustness and stability of the energy storage battery during use, in any embodiment, a second limit structure may be provided between the base 100 and the adjacent battery module 300, and a third limit structure may be provided between the control module 500 and the adjacent battery module 300. The second and third limit structures here may be similar to the first limit structure in Example 1 and will not be further described here. However, because the control module 500 is located at the top end of the energy storage battery, it is only necessary to provide a positioning hole 6 at the bottom of the control module 500, which is compatible with the battery module 300 located at the top of the energy storage unit, and it is not necessary to provide a protruding post 1 at the top of the control module 500. Because the base 100 is located at the bottom end of the energy storage battery, it is only necessary to provide a protruding post 1 at the top of the base 100, which is compatible with the battery module 300 located at the bottom of the energy storage unit, and it is not necessary to provide a positioning hole 6 at the bottom of the base 100.
